FIRST INTERNATIONAL CONGRESS ON APPLIED SCIENCE AND TECHNOLOGY PRESENTED BY UTM A SUCCESS

 

34 lecturers from 9 countries gathered
First International Congress on Applied Science and Technology presented by UTM a great success

The First International Congress of Applied Science and Technology and the Plenary Forum on Energy organized by the Technological University of Matamoros, in compliance with the actions in the area of education outlined in the State Development Plan promoted by the Constitutional Governor of Tamaulipas, Egidio Torre Cantu, brought together 34 scientists and researchers from Germany, Bulgaria, Spain, the United States, Mexico, England, Iran, Israel and Armenia.

This great event, which also aimed to strengthen the scientific, technological and competitiveness capacities of the productive sectors, was inaugurated by Monica Gonzalez Garcia, Secretary of Economic Development and Tourism and personal representative of the Governor of Tamaulipas, during an event attended by Mayor Norma Leticia Salazar Vazquez, the rector of UTM, Jose Antonio Tovar Lara and hundreds of attendees.

The rector of the institution welcomed the representatives of the private sector, civil society, students from institutions throughout the state, researchers and academics, university rectors, high school principals and elementary school children who have excelled in science and technology.

It is a great satisfaction, he said, to know that all of us gathered here to have a common interest; we are united by our interest in scientific and technological development because we know that the prosperity of the people depends to a great extent on the proper application of science and technology.

In the presence also of Patricio Garza Tapia, Director of the Ministry of Education, Tovar Lara highlighted the participation of UTM students, who last April represented Mexico in the Vex Robotics World Championship, held in Anaheim, California, and were among the ten best robotics teams in the world.

The opening ceremony of the First Congress of Applied Science and Technology was also attended by very special guests such as the most brilliant children of science and technology in the city, among them, «a young girl who has captivated us with her intelligence and simplicity, who has been on the cover of Time magazine and has become a role model, I am referring to Paloma Marlene Noyola Bueno».

Mónica González Garcìa, Secretary of Economic Development and Tourism said in her message that the Governor of Tamaulipas, Mr. Egidio Torre Cantú, is a promoter of innovation, research and technology transfer as he considers them fundamental factors in economic development because it is precisely through technological development that we can bring more productive investment with added value and better-paid jobs, both in the already consolidated industrial sectors, as well as to take advantage of the energy reform to a greater extent.

He congratulated the Technological University of Matamoros for making this meeting of scientists and researchers possible and reiterated his commitment to continue working with businessmen and educational institutions to achieve, together, greater opportunities for all.

Mayor Norma Leticia Salazar Vázquez also congratulated the Technological University of Matamoros for organizing such significant events. I am sure,» she said, «that through events like this, we not only open opportunities for new professionals and young people who are pursuing their professional careers but also ensure a successful and innovative tomorrow for our great city.
